Re: Post Your 60-63 Body Style Chevy/GMC Trucks

They gave me a hood that had a really crappy mold. It didn't line up in any way and the construction was horrible. The top, rear of the hood where it meets the cowl panel was 3/4" high on one side and 7/8" on the other. Once brought down, The mold was so thin, light could be seen even with the blacked out underside. They did a crappy job of blocking it also. And they had used two different primers on the top because it appears that they noticed a particularly crappy section and attempted to fix it. Everytime we sanded it down and blew it off more pinholes appeared which had to be drilled/filled. It's a crappy job in all aspects and I expect that the hood used for the mold was atleast half rusted out. I'll never do business with them again.
